Photographs capture typhoon aftermath in Leamington exhibition

Images of some of the areas most badly affected by the recent Typhoon Haiyan Yolanda in the Phillippines, taken by photojournalist Alison Baskerville, will be on display at the Lounge’s function room in the Parade, Leamington, on Sunday (December 8) from 3pm to 8pm.

Entry is free but visitors will have the opportunity to give donations for the victims.
